Bus Bar Connection Structure with Insulation Paper Rotation Prevention

Resolve Bottlenecks,
Find Innovative Solutions
Generate Solutions

Solution Overview

Problem

Conventional bus bar connection structures face issues with maintaining electrical and mechanical connections to circuit boards due to thermal stress, which can cause loosening and insulation breakdown, especially when using metal circuit boards for heat dissipation.

Innovation Solution

Incorporating an insulation paper piece between the bus bar and the nut or bolt, along with a rotation-preventing recess to prevent the insulation paper piece from rotating and deforming under torque, ensuring stable electrical and mechanical connections.

A bus bar connection structure includes a housing, a circuit board including metal, and a bus bar that are disposed in order from a lower side, a lower nut including metal and disposed in an upper surface-side of the housing in a state in which the lower nut is embedded in the housing, and a bolt including metal. On an upper surface of the circuit board, an insulation layer and a copper foil pattern are formed in order from a lower side. An insulation paper piece is disposed between the lower nut and the circuit board. The bolt is screwed into the lower nut in a state in which the bolt is inserted through the insulation paper piece, the circuit board, the insulation layer, the copper foil pattern, and the bus bar. A rotation-preventing part is further provided, the rotation-preventing part preventing the insulation paper piece from rotating due to torque generated during fastening of the bolt.
